Rick Santelli blasted the liberal medias reporting on todays dismal unemployment numbers. The CNBC star ridiculed the Ostrich Economics being pushed by the Obama-media.
Heres Santelli on the latest unemployment data.
There are some highlights Id really like to hit. The first one is that about 41.3% of unemployed have been unemployed for 39.1 weeks. That is huge and pretty much says it all. This is the weakest recovery since the Great Depression. A whole 4/5ths of the drop of the unemployment rate is due to a drop in the labor force participation. It is the lowest since 1981.
Many of regiohal news shows were reporting on just the unemployment rate. Thats ostrich economics.
